whats a good non stick one?

I wouldnt buy anything else apart from licensed Nintendo products, so I'd go for the Hori ones like I did. Easily to remove if you want, just use some scotch tape and pull them off.. they're hard to apply though. They're non sticky as well btw, I mean they don't use any sort of glue.

I use a Hori. I never really had trouble applying it ... maybe I just got lucky. I did it in the bathroom to minimize dust ... and blew the screen a little until there was no dust, held my breath, and applied it. No bubbles, no nothing.

I just have ONE tiny complaint. The bottom screen doesn't fit EXACTLY ... like ... I squared it off with the left side of the touchscreen ... but I have this little gap on the right side. And I was sort of afraid to take it off and reapply ...
